## Local Setup

The autocomplete index for QuillSearch rebuilds on first boot and it is slow — expect ten minutes on a cold checkout. Do not interrupt it; a partial index causes empty suggestion lists that look like a bug but aren't. Run the seeder once, then start the dev server. The indexer reads source rows directly from the catalog database using the connection string below.

primary connection of tajeg-tajop = postgresql://julax_svc:DI@db-e7f3.kelvidyn.corp:5432/rusdor

When reviewing fixes to the Bramblefen orphaned-resource sweeper, confirm that recovery of a quarantined account restores ownership links before the sweeper's next pass; otherwise resources are deleted permanently. Test against the frozen staging snapshot, which must be decrypted before use. Decryption requires the team's recovery passphrase, which for reviewer convenience is recorded directly below this paragraph.

vault phrase of bagaf-kajeg = jorath-feniel-briir-siliel-ralix

Subject: DR drill next Thursday — Tideline widget

Hi Priya,

Quick heads-up: we're running the disaster-recovery drill for the Tideline tide-table widget next Thursday morning. Plan is to kill the primary feed in Saltmere, fail over to the backup region, and time how long charts stay stale. Nothing customer-facing should wobble, but keep the release train paused until we're done. To unlock the standby console during the drill you'll need the recovery passphrase, which is right below.

strongbox words: eliius-pelath-sorius-oliys-noviel

Leadership Review Briefing — Logistics Provider Change

Sales leads should be aware that Ferrowind Distribution will replace Calder Freight as our primary carrier from next quarter. Transition covers the Halvern and Rooksmere routes first, with delivery windows tightening by roughly one day. Expect brief disruption during the cutover fortnight. The rationale connects to the point noted below.

internal memo for fajog-yagaf: Gross margin on Ulaael came in at 20 percent against a plan of 10 percent. Only 9 of the 80 pilot accounts renewed Ulaael, so a churn review is set for July 1.